Launched in 2016 by the Government of West Bengal, Swasthya Sathi is aimed at providing health coverage to the most marginalized sections of society. This scheme underscores the government’s vision of delivering holistic healthcare services to the neediest, thereby leaving no one behind in the pursuit of making India, a healthier nation.

There are several benefits that the Swasthya Sathi healthcare scheme extends to its beneficiaries, making it one of the most sought-after health insurance plans.

Comprehensive Coverage: One of the most distinguishing factors of the Swasthya Sathi scheme is its comprehensive coverage. It offers a basic health cover of up to INR 5 lakh annually on a family floater basis. This means that any member of the family or the entire family can avail of the healthcare benefits up to the allotted insurance limit.

Wide-ranging Medical Services: The Swasthya Sathi scheme encompasses a wide array of medical services, including hospitalization costs, surgical procedures, critical illness treatment, and even pre-existing diseases. The beneficiaries of the scheme are also covered for secondary and tertiary care procedures, making the package inclusive and beneficial for all.

Cashless Treatment: Swasthya Sathi is a paperless and cashless scheme, which adds to the convenience and ease to the beneficiaries. Under this scheme, beneficiaries can access health services without paying upfront at the network hospitals. Hence, ensuring healthcare is readily available without the worry of immediate payments.

Family Coverage: The unique feature of the Swasthya Sathi healthcare scheme is that it provides coverage to the entire family, including parents from both spouses’ sides. The scheme includes coverage for the eldest female member of the family as the primary beneficiary, emphasizing women’s empowerment and security.

TPA services: The Swasthya Sathi healthcare scheme offers TPA (Third Party Administrator) facility for effective claim settlements. This means beneficiaries can seek the necessary help with claim management, ensuring a smooth and hassle-free process.

Transparency: The scheme emphasizes a high degree of transparency, with all pertinent details available on the Swasthya Sathi app and website. This includes information related to the empaneled hospitals, claim process, covered benefits, etc. This empowers the beneficiaries by providing them with all the necessary information required to make informed decisions about their health and well-being.

100% Government-funded: The Swasthya Sathi scheme is fully funded by the Government, making it free for all the beneficiaries. This increases the accessibility of the scheme, ensuring the underprivileged and marginalized sections of society have fair and impartial access to essential healthcare services.

Furthermore, Swasthya Sathi does not discriminate based on income, profession, or health conditions, opening up pathways for everyone to avail themselves of the enormous benefits it offers.
